Detalles del Curso
โข Introduction to Computational Genomics: Overview of computational genomics, its applications, and importance in gene editing. This unit covers primary concepts, tools, and techniques used in computational genomics.
โข Genome Sequencing and Assembly: Deep dive into genome sequencing technologies, data analysis, and genome assembly techniques. This unit covers secondary and tertiary genome assembly methods and their applications in gene editing.
โข Genome Annotation and Analysis: Exploration of genome annotation techniques and tools, including gene prediction, functional annotation, and comparative genome analysis. This unit covers both prokaryotic and eukaryotic genome annotation methods.
โข Population Genomics and Phylogenetics: Overview of population genomics and phylogenetics, including concepts such as genetic variation, linkage disequilibrium, and population structure. This unit covers methods for inferring population history and evolutionary relationships using genomic data.
โข Gene Regulation and Expression Analysis: Study of gene regulation and expression analysis, including transcriptional regulation, post-transcriptional regulation, and epigenetic modifications. This unit covers experimental and computational methods for analyzing gene expression data.
โข CRISPR-Cas9 Gene Editing: Comprehensive review of CRISPR-Cas9 gene editing technology, including its mechanisms, applications, and limitations. This unit covers both theoretical and practical aspects of CRISPR-Cas9 gene editing.
โข Advanced Gene Editing Techniques: Overview of advanced gene editing techniques, including base editing, prime editing, and gene therapy. This unit covers the latest developments in gene editing technology and their potential applications.
โข Genomics Ethics and Regulations: Exploration of ethical and regulatory issues related to computational genomics and gene editing. This unit covers topics such as data privacy, genetic discrimination, and gene editing regulations in different countries.
